Math.ILogB(Double) 方法

定义

返回指定数字以 2 为底的整数对数。

public:
 static int ILogB(double x);
public static int ILogB (double x);
static member ILogB : double -> int
Public Shared Function ILogB (x As Double) As Integer

参数

x
Double

要查找其对数的数字。

返回

下表中的值之一。

x 参数 返回值
默认 x 以 2 为底的整数对数,即 (int)log2(x)。
Int32.MinValue
等于 NaNPositiveInfinityNegativeInfinityInt32.MaxValue

注解

参数 x 指定为基数 10。

此方法调用基础 C 运行时,不同的操作系统或体系结构之间的确切结果或有效输入范围可能会有所不同。

适用于